Webb10 mars 2024 · The Western Australian Department of Health outlines some simple steps you can try to incorporate to drag yourself away from your screens. These include: Limit non-work screen time. Keep bedrooms screen-free. Make mealtimes free of TVs, smartphones and other screens. Use the time during TV ads to be physically active.
